A charity bin in the south of the Island has been stolen.
Authorities say it was taken overnight on Tuesday from the Southern Amenity Site in Port Erin.
Police say it was half full with mobile phones and tablets, which were supposed to be recycled to raise money for charity.
Officers are asking anyone who knows those responsible, or knows the whereabouts of the bin to get in touch with Castletown Police Station.
